Can I > really > > get a reasonably functional machine from these machines? > > The primary design goal of these x86 CPUs is low power usage. In > fact, they just released a *passively cooled* 733MHz CPU. > > To obtain this goal, though, the sacrificed speed. Floating point > execution is particularly dreadful. So, you won't be playing any > 1st person shooters... > > On the other hand, my 1GHz Athlon plays FPS games well, but sounds > like a Boeing 737 is parked 2.5m from my head. > > So, what's important to you? Speed or silence?
